Ticket: FIELD-2281 — Expired credentials blocking offline sync

For the weekly sync: the Heronpath field-survey app's offline mode stopped reconciling on Monday because the cached sync token expired while crews were out of coverage. Surveys queued locally are intact, but uploads fail silently until re-auth. We've extended token lifetime to 30 days and reissued credentials. The replacement key for the internal sync service follows.

service key, fafog-fahaf: vxb3-x55

# Break-Glass: Catalog Cache Invalidation

Scope: the Pinrow product catalog at Veldstone Retail. If stale prices persist after a purge and the Hollowmere invalidation queue is wedged, use break-glass to flush the edge tier directly. Contractors: get verbal sign-off from the catalog lead first. Steps: open the Hollowmere admin shell, select emergency-flush, confirm the tenant, and run it once — repeated flushes thrash the origin. Access is logged and expires after 20 minutes. Unseal the admin shell with the passphrase below.

recovery phrase for kahop-tajog: istix-casvan

Facilities ticket — Halewick Tower, night shift.

Issue: support team reporting east stairwell reader rejecting badges after midnight. Reader was reset this morning; firmware updated. Overnight crew should now badge as normal. If the reader fails again, use the manual keypad by the fire door — do not prop the door. Log any further failures with the time and badge name. Temporary keypad code for the fallback door is below.

door code, tajeg-fawip: bdg-K-62

# Flush interval for the Grackle metrics sidecar.
# Lower values hammer the aggregator; higher values risk losing
# a window of counters on pod eviction. 15s is the tested sweet spot.
# On-call: if counters flatline, restart the sidecar before touching this.
# Verify you're on the build matching the token below.

build token for fahap-yagag: htk3_d09

**Timeline — Querymast planner regression**

09:17 — Dashboard latency alerts fired for the reporting cluster. 09:31 — Marisol traced slow queries to a plan change favoring nested loops over hash joins. 09:52 — Confirmed the regression landed with Tuesday's optimizer cost-model tweak. 10:15 — Feature flag disabled the new cost model; latencies normalized within six minutes. The deploy that introduced the regression is identified below.

session token of kageg-tahop = htk14_af3c1ccccb7dcf